| 571 nm Class 4 Continuous Wave Laser Module | |
Laser
from Frankfurt Laser Company
|
| The GLM-571-1000-2555 from Frankfurt Laser Company is a Yellow Laser Module that operates at a wavelength of 571 nm. It delivers a minimum CW output power of 800 mW with power stability of ± 5% and maximum spectral bandwidth of 1 nm. This class 4 laser produces a longitudinal beam of diameter 0.5 mm and beam divergence of 30 mrad. It has a maximum beam alignment tolerance of 0.5 mm (position) (at the output window) and 35 mrad (off-axis angle). |

| 1060 nm MEMS-VCSEL Laser for Non-Invasive Medical Imaging Applications | |
Laser
from OCTLIGHT
|
| The Caliper-HERO from OCTLIGHT is a MEMS-VCSEL Laser that operates at a center wavelength of 1060 nm. It has two models: standard & superior which deliver an optical output power above 15 mW (standard) & 15 - 50 mW (superior). This tunable laser is ideal for non-invasive medical imaging for wide-field ophthalmic imaging, fast image acquisition, ultra-fast depth monitoring and LiDAR applications. |

| 878 nm Single Bar Laser Diode for Pumping & Printing Applications | |
Laser Diode
from BWT BEIJING
|
| The M10Y-878.3-60C- 1x1 from BWT BEIJING is a Single Bar Laser Diode that operates at a center wavelength of 878 nm. It delivers an output power of 60 W per bar and has a wavelength accuracy of ± 3 nm with a bandwidth below 5 nm (FWHM). This conduction-cooled laser diode has a slope efficiency above 1.1 W/A and is ideal for pumping, printing, scientific research, and industrial applications. |

| 920 nm Fiber Coupled Laser Diode for Material Processing Applications | |
Laser Diode
from Fibotec
|
| The PHS-F1N934004-01 from Fibotec is a Fiber Coupled Laser Diode that operates at a wavelength of 920 nm. It has 4 laser diodes integrated into a subsystem and delivers an output power of 2.5 W per channel. This laser diode has a maximum rise or fall time of 200 ns and is ideal for the printing industry, other graphic arts, material processing & sensing instrument applications. |

| 880 nm Phototransistor for Edge Sensing & Smoke Detector Applications | |
Phototransistor
from Marktech Optoelectronics
|
| The MTD8000N4-T from Marktech Optoelectronics is a Phototransistor that has a peak wavelength of 880 nm. It has a spectral sensitivity of 400 nm - 1100 nm and switching time (rise/fall) of 10 µs. This phototransistor has a light current of 3 mA and maximum dark current of 100 nA. It is ideal for optical switches, edge sensing, fiber optical communications, and smoke detector applications. |

| 400 nm - 495 nm, Color Glass Optical Filters for Bandpass Filter Applications | |
Optical Filter
from Optics and Allied Engineering Pvt. Ltd.
|
| The GG Series from Optics and Allied Engineering Pvt. Ltd. are Color Glass Optical Filters that allow transmission at a wavelength of 400 nm - 495 nm. They have a tolerance of ± 0.2mm, parallelism of up to 1 arc minutes, and flatness of 2 lambda (at 632.8nm). These Yellow glass optical filters have a clear aperture of greater than 90% and are ideal for long-pass and bandpass filter applications. |

| 1000 nm NIR Spectrometer for Spectral Domain-OCT Systems & OEM Applications | |
Spectrometer
from New Span Opto-Technology Inc.
|
| The SP-1020 from New Span Opto-Technology Inc. is an NIR Spectrometer that operates at a wavelength of 1000 nm. It uses a GL2048L InGaAs Linescan Camera with 2048 pixels and supports an A-scan rate of up to 78000 A-scan per second. This spectrometer uses an FC-APC fiber connector and is ideal for spectral domain optical coherence tomography (SD-OCT) systems and OEM applications. |
